So apparently, Dreamhack was a major success, not only with the venue and event itself but also the numbers to support all this.
Statistics
Total views: 6,755,728
Unique viewers: 1,673,270
Peak concurrent viewers: 94,932

Please be advised that numbers from Swedish National Television is not included in these statistics.

Also, they had 20,984 live visitors. I don't know if they mean visitors as in people watching or people participating in the LAN event.
Seeing these numbers is really amazing and props to DreamHack for this event. It had overall a really nice quality and besides all the drama around some issues, I liked the event.

According to Fredrik Nyström they broke records!
DreamHack broke three earlier records (attendance, network capacity and usage) and now we break our fourth record when presenting 1,7 million unique viewers on our livestreams said Fredrik Nyström, press officer at DreamHack


Would be nice to see the official numbers by the National TV station. It would be great if anyone had a link to that. I mainly watched DreamHack for SC2 and to be honest, it was kinda new to me that they also had other games like Bloodline Champions:
DreamHack offered over 21 high definition competitive video gaming channels including StarCraft II, Quake Live, and Counter-Strike 1.6, Super Street Fighter IV Arcade Edition, Dota 2, Heroes Of Newerth and Bloodline Champions in addition to stage channels from DreamArena Extreme, DreamArena AMD Sapphire and the main DreamHack stage.
